You might be wondering what gray water is and why it’s a big deal. Gray water is wastewater generated from household activities like washing machines, dishwashers, and sinks. It can contain b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ants that can cause serious health problems if not handled properly.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) Cost In Farr West, UT

The cost of gray water extraction in Farr West,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and works closely with you to ensure that you understand the costs involved. Get an estimate today and let us take care of the rest.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Disinfection and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and level of contamination.
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area.
